Widespread Panic, Zedd top CounterPoint lineup
Get ready to Panic this Memorial Day weekend.
Widespread Panic headlines the CounterPoint Music and Arts Festival May 22-24 in Kingston Downs, Ga., just outside of Atlanta. The Southern jam band, also playing the New Orleans Jazz and Heritage Festival earlier that month, will be joined by Zedd, The Roots, and Rebelution at the three-day fest.
Electronic acts such as Knife Party, Dillon Francis and Zeds Dead are among the bill's other best-known artists, as are up-and-comers such as Robert DeLong, iLoveMakonnen, Chet Faker, Gorgon City and Cherub.
The 5,000-acre venue includes four performance stages, standard and luxury camping areas, and The Midway section, which features carnival rides, games, yoga workshops and dining.
